WebThe most visible aspect of the Muslim dress code is the hijab, which refers to the headscarf that Muslim women wear. The hijab is worn to cover a woman’s hair, neck and shoulders, and it symbolizes respect, piety, and dignity. Apart from the hijab, there are other requirements for Muslim dress as well.
